Hi, i wanna calculate/simulate the power output of the wind turbine blade. When i use the BEM method, i will simulate the power of a 2D airfoil, then integrate all the airfoils to the the whole power of the 3D blade, which is introduced in the BEM theory.
but when it comes to CFD method, i don't know how to get the power in theory or in the software. can anyone tell me the theory abt how to calculate the power in CFD? or any material abt that? or how to simulate the power in CFD software, like ansys CFX/fluent? thank you in advance |
